Internet Connection: Required for initial software activation and web-based asset downloads.
Virtual Machines: Twinmotion 2016 is not officially supported on virtual machines; it should be installed on a physical machine for stability.
macOS: While later versions became heavily optimized for Mac, 2016 was primarily focused on Windows, with Mac support requiring at least OS X 10.13.6 and Metal-compatible GPUs for related iterations.

Twinmotion 2016 was a major milestone for the software, released by Abvent in late 2015. While it is now a legacy version compared to the current Twinmotion 2026.1, it set the foundation for many features still in use today, such as Google Earth topology import and point cloud support. 💻 Twinmotion 2016 System Requirements
The hardware landscape in 2016 was significantly different. Below are the original specifications required to run this version: Windows 7 / 8 / 10 (64-bit) Minimum Requirements Recommended Specs CPU Intel Core 2 Duo (2.4 GHz) Quad-core (3.0 GHz+) RAM 8 GB – 16 GB GPU 1 GB VRAM (GTX 460) 4 GB VRAM (GTX 770) Storage 5 GB available space 5 GB available space DirectX Version 11 Version 11 or 12 macOS (OS X 10.13.6 or later) CPU: Intel Core i5 or AMD (2.5 GHz+) RAM: 8 GB Minimum / 32 GB Recommended GPU: 8 GB VRAM / AMD Radeon Vega series or higher 🚀 Key Features & Updates in 2016
The 2016 update was marketed as a bridge between CAD and real-time visualization. Notable additions included:
BIMmotion: A standalone executable file that allowed clients to explore projects without having Twinmotion installed.
Environment Tools: New terrain sculpting brushes and a revised seasonal simulation system.
External Data: Support for importing Google Earth topology and photogrammetry/point cloud data.
Control: Support for Xbox One and PS4 controllers for navigating scenes. ⚡ The Modern Comparison (2026)
